Episode Summary:

The podcast episode featured a guest, Vaultec, discussing various projects on the Hive blockchain, particularly focusing on Virtual Smart Contracts (VSC) and decentralized applications within the Hive ecosystem. The discussion highlighted the significance of scalability, smart contract functionalities, and the innovative use of IPFS technology in enhancing blockchain platforms. Topics included the VSC project's aim to revolutionize smart contracts on Hive, fee structures for smart contract interactions, and the potential implications for the Hive blockchain ecosystem.

Detailed Article:

The podcast episode delved into the innovative developments within the Hive blockchain ecosystem, with a spotlight on Virtual Smart Contracts (VSC) and the SPK Network. The guest, Vaultec, shared insights into his journey in the cryptocurrency space and his involvement in projects like 3Speak and the SPK Network.

The conversation emphasized VSC's role in enhancing smart contract capabilities and scalability on Hive. VSC distinguishes itself by offering a generalist approach to smart contracts, aiming to enable a broader range of deployments with a focus on scalability. The unique data storage approach on IPFS sets VSC apart from existing projects like dlux, allowing for efficient data shedding and sharding to manage large volumes of contract data effectively.

One key aspect discussed was VSC's utilization of IPFS for data storage, enabling a lightweight transaction structure that enhances scalability and efficiency. The platform's focus on specific data indexing based on contract needs contributes to its scalability and functionality.

The episode also tackled the debate surrounding smart contracts on-chain versus off-chain, with an emphasis on addressing scalability concerns through off-chain operations while retaining core functionalities on-chain. Future possibilities enabled by VSC, such as tokenization, NFTs, and gaming initiatives like Splinterlands, were highlighted as key use cases that could benefit from VSC's enhanced smart contract functionalities.

Fee structures for smart contract interactions were detailed, including base fees for executions and incentives for node participation in contract creation. The seamless handling of operations within smart contracts, with a single fee regardless of task complexity, underscored VSC's user-friendly approach.

The episode concluded with a peek into the potential impact of introducing HBD (Hive-backed dollars) to the Hive blockchain ecosystem and hinted at future integrations with platforms like ThreeSpeak. The collaborative efforts within the blockchain community to enhance user experiences, drive adoption, and foster innovation were central themes throughout the discussion.

In essence, the episode provided a comprehensive exploration of VSC, highlighting its role in advancing smart contract functionalities and scalability on the Hive blockchain. The detailed insights into fee structures, technical implementations, and use cases for VSC underscored the ongoing efforts to propel blockchain platforms like Hive towards greater adoption and functionality in the decentralized landscape.
